5. Legal Basis

We process your personal data based on one or more of the following legal grounds under the GDPR:

  • Performance of a contract (Art. 6(1)(b) GDPR): processing necessary to fulfil a contract with you or to take steps at your request before entering into a contract (e.g., managing bookings).
  • Consent (Art. 6(1)(a) GDPR): you have given clear consent for us to process your personal data for a specific purpose (e.g., marketing communications, analytics cookies).
  • Compliance with legal obligations (Art. 6(1)(c) GDPR): processing necessary to comply with laws to which we are subject (e.g., health and safety record keeping).
  • Legitimate interests (Art. 6(1)(f) GDPR): processing necessary for our legitimate interests or those of a third party, except where such interests are overridden by your rights and freedoms.

10. Your Rights Under GDPR

Under the GDPR, you have the following rights regarding your personal data:

  • Right to access: request a copy of the personal data we hold about you.
  • Right to rectification: request correction of inaccurate or incomplete data.
  • Right to erasure ("right to be forgotten"): request deletion of your personal data where there is no compelling reason for us to continue processing it.
  • Right to restrict processing: request that we restrict the processing of your data under certain conditions.
  • Right to object: object to the processing of your personal data where we are relying on legitimate interests or processing for direct marketing purposes.
  • Right to data portability: request transfer of your personal data to you or to another controller in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format.
  • Right to withdraw consent: withdraw consent at any time where we are relying on consent to process your personal data.

You also have the right to lodge a complaint with the Spanish supervisory authority, the Agencia Española de Protección de Datos (AEPD), if you believe your data protection rights have been violated.
